Talent Development leaders say "employees don’t want to learn."
Before we jump to that conclusion, let’s ask ourselves - What have we done to motivate them?
Here are 6 ways to inspire learning with Social Learning:
5/ Find the right experts
Employees want to learn from people who walk the talk. They need Thinkfluencers who can share real-world examples and experiences.
Find the right people to share this knowledge.
Authentic and relevant content will inspire your employees to learn.
4/ Focus on application and impact
No one wants to learn because ‘they have to!’ You can’t force them to learn. Show them the impact of learning and its real-world application.
'Learning without application' is ‘mobile without internet’. What’s the point?
3/ If it's not personalized, it's not for them.
Learning should be designed for the learner.
In a world of Spotify, Netflix and AirBnb, everything is personalized.
Then why should learning be a one-size-fits-none approach?
2/ Mobile comes first.
Most learning solutions are designed for desktops & depressing UX for mobiles. Employees today spend the majority of their time on smartphones. So design learning that’s responsive for the mobile.
Ease of access + Convenience = More time spent learning
1/ Ditch old-school learning methods.
Why is learning content still driven by information-loaded powerpoints and boring classroom-style videos.
In a world of TikTok and Reels, bite-sized content is what people want.
